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#3A7F98 is classified in the Register under the Azure Color Family, with Moderate Saturation and Light brightness. Its exact recipe is rgb(58, 127, 152) — 22.7% red, 49.8% green, 59.6% blue — and for print it converts to CMYK 37 / 10 / 0 / 40.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#3A7F98 presents itself as a clearly saturated steel-blue azure — one that feels open and friendly. It is a natural fit for understated, calm designs that favor harmony over drama. In The Official Register of Color Names it is practically indistinguishable from Waterfront (#3E7F9D).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Dirty Blue (#3F829D) and Jelly Bean Blue (#44798E).

The recipe behind #3A7F98 is rgb(58, 127, 152), with blue as the dominant ingredient. If you plan to put text on a #3A7F98 background, choose black — the contrast ratio is 4.7:1 (passing WCAG AA), while white manages only 4.5:1. No one has named #3A7F98 so far. #3A7F98 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
